Teachers’ creativity-fostering behaviours and emotional intelligence as predictors of students’ performance in circle geometry
This research examines how teachers‘ creativity-fostering behaviours and emotional intelligence can predict their students’ performance in circular geometry. The study was guided by two research questions and two hypotheses, and the research methodology employed was that of a survey. The starting p...
